Transaction a79f4cc6431ae884624376134b3a46d341070ea8a8683b7aae65c82038605f37

11 Input
2 Outputs
  • a79f4cc6431ae884624376134b3a46d341070ea8a8683b7aae65c82038605f37:0
  • value  2537642279
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• a79f4cc6431ae884624376134b3a46d341070ea8a8683b7aae65c82038605f37:1
  • value  907229
    address  37auecYutkFpU8USDgzwaf9VWiojFPcmqj